Primary Duties and Responsibilities

Join our Ophthalmology team as an Ultrasound Technologist and play a vital role in both patient care and innovative research. In this position, you will perform diagnostic ultrasound and ultrasound biomicroscopy examinations, ocular coherence tomography, and intra-ocular lens implant power calculations. You will collaborate on research studies involving ocular tumors, macular pathology, ocular inflammatory disease, glaucoma, and orbital abnormalities, while also training and mentoring Ophthalmology Fellows and Residents in imaging techniques. In addition, you will interpret and document diagnostic findings for faculty review. 

We are looking for someone with experience in ophthalmic ultrasound, knowledge of OCT and ocular imaging techniques, strong clinical and technical skills, and a passion for patient care and teaching.
